Product Manager - Marquee

Marquee Product Managers are shaping the future of digital finance. Marquee's Product Management team - in partnership with Marquee's Design, Engineering, AI, Sales and Marketing teams - delivers innovative, industry-changing products and experiences to Goldman Sachs' institutional clients. Marquee Product Managers define complex product strategies and guide interdisciplinary teams to expertly deliver them to the market.

Responsibilities

• Translate user requirements to underlying design/solution to dev specifications • Work with dev, architect, UX teams to shape the core modules of Marquee Portfolio Analytics • Work with UX team to ensure consistency and incorporation of client feedback • Balance new functionality, bugs, and client requests • Assign commercial opportunities to work queue • Prioritize potential initiatives by understanding alignment with business strategy and value generated for current and future users • Establish Metrics of Usage and track OKRs • Track client usage, production issues, system stability • Establish usage metrics and production monitoring system KPIs to improve end user experience • Track OKRs • Build Platform Collateral • Build demo and training libraries • Manage internal communication, updates, trainings for new feature releases • Develop, communicate and continuously refine product roadmaps that deliver innovative and engaging products

Basic Qualifications

A Bachelor's Degree in Computer Science, Engineering or a related fields like Mathematics, Physics, Statistics is required. Strong quantitative background in order to support financial analytics products and data driven decision making is also necessary. Proven experience in, and a passion for, building and shipping cutting edge financial and/or data products is highly valued. Exceptional communication skills are also required. Capability to apply a blend of strategic and tactical approaches to problems, creative design thinking, strong business acumen and technical know-how are essential. Comfort with working in a rapidly evolving environment and ability to navigate and influence the organization with ease are also necessary. Tenacity is also required. Someone who is willing to go beyond their comfort zone, as needed.

Preferred Qualifications

Experience in building and executing digital roadmaps within a financial context and experience working with data and API products, platforms and capabilities are highly preferred.
